The Noble Auxiliary is a group of women who meet once a month, usually on the second Thursday of the month at 6:30pm to plan and implement Noble of Indiana's largest fundraising event called A Noble Evening in the Garden. The money raised at this event benefits children and adults with developmental disabilities. The Noble Auxiliary also has an outreach committee which plans different volunteer activities at Noble of Indiana's 4 different day programs around the Greater Indianapolis area.

Auxiliary members will receive a short orientation in order for them to learn more about Noble of Indiana's mission and the individuals we serve.
